JOB SUMMARY

The Desktop Support System Administrator plays a crucial role in maintaining, optimizing, and securing IT systems to ensure seamless daily operations for end-users. This position is responsible for troubleshooting hardware, software, and network issues, managing system security, and ensuring compliance with organizational policies. They will configure, monitor, and troubleshoot servers, networks, workstations, and security systems, ensuring optimal performance, reliability, and cybersecurity.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S:

Provide Tier 1/2 technical support, troubleshooting hardware, software, and network issues for end-users.

Manage and resolve helpdesk ticket escalations efficiently.

Support and maintain desktops, laptops, mobile devices, and peripherals.

Install, configure, and maintain operating systems and enterprise applications.

Administer Active Directory, managing user accounts, permissions, and access rights.

Assist with employee onboarding and offboarding, including provisioning and deprovisioning IT resources.

Educate users on best practices for security, software usage, and IT policies.

Monitor and maintain IT infrastructure, including servers, networks, and cloud-based services.

Implement cybersecurity best practices, including patch management, system hardening, and access controls.

Install, configure, and maintain Windows and Linux servers as well as enterprise applications.

Manage cloud environments (Azure, AWS) and virtualized platforms (VMware vSphere).

Administer network infrastructure, including LAN/WAN, VPNs, firewalls, and other networking components.

Ensure data integrity, backup reliability, and disaster recovery readiness.

Maintain and troubleshoot enterprise applications, including email, collaboration tools, and cloud services.

Ensure compliance with IT security policies, regulatory requirements, and industry standards.

Maintain system documentation, incident reports, and compliance records

POSITION REQUIREMENTS

Bachelor’s degree in IT, Computer Science, or equivalent experience.

3+ years of experience in system administration or technical support.

Strong knowledge of Windows Server, Linux, Active Directory, and Group Policy.

Experience with networking protocols and technologies (TCP/IP, DNS, DHCP, VPN, firewalls).

Familiarity with cybersecurity frameworks (NIST, ISO 27001).

Strong troubleshooting, analytical, and communication skills.

Ability to explain technical concepts clearly to non-technical users.

Certifications: CompTIA Security+, Microsoft (MCSA/MCP), Linux+, AWS, Azure.

Experience in DoD environments (RMF, STIGs, DISA compliance).

Knowledge of IT compliance standards and system hardening best practices.
